I. Education
Computers have revolutionized the way we learn and acquire knowledge. Here are some key points regarding the role of computers in education:
1. Access to vast information resources: Computers provide access to a vast array of information sources, such as online libraries, educational websites, and e-books, enabling students and teachers to explore various subjects and deepen their understanding.
2. Interactive learning: With the help of educational software and online platforms, students can engage in interactive learning experiences that promote better understanding and retention of information.
3. Distance education: Computers have made distance education possible, allowing students to attend classes and receive a quality education from anywhere in the world.
4. Collaboration and communication: Computers facilitate communication and collaboration among students and teachers, making it easier to share ideas and work on group projects.
II. Career
Computers have transformed the job market, creating new opportunities and requiring employees to possess certain digital skills. Here are some points highlighting the impact of computers in the workplace:
1. Increased productivity: Computers enable employees to complete tasks more efficiently, leading to increased productivity and reduced workload.
2. Advanced technology in various industries: Computers have become essential in fields such as medicine, engineering, and finance, where they are used to analyze data, create simulations, and develop new products.
3. Job-specific software: Many careers require employees to be proficient in specific software applications, such as Adobe Photoshop for graphic designers or Microsoft Excel for financial analysts.
4. Remote work: The rise of computers has made remote work possible, allowing employees to work from home or any location, improving work-life balance.
III. Personal Development
Computers have also played a significant role in personal development, enabling individuals to learn new skills, connect with others, and explore hobbies. Here are some key points:
1. Skill development: Computers offer a wide range of online courses and tutorials that allow individuals to learn new skills, such as coding, photography, or language learning.
2. Social media and communication: Computers and the internet have made it easier for people to stay connected with friends and family, share experiences, and build communities.
3. Entertainment: Computers provide access to various forms of entertainment, including movies, music, and video games, allowing individuals to relax and unwind.
4. Health and fitness: With the help of fitness apps and online resources, computers can be used to track workouts, set health goals, and maintain a healthy lifestyle.
IV. Challenges and Concerns
While computers have brought numerous benefits to our lives, they also pose certain challenges and concerns, such as:
1. Digital divide: Not everyone has access to computers and the internet, which can create disparities in education and career opportunities.
2. Privacy and security: As more personal information is stored online, privacy and security concerns have become increasingly important.
3. Screen time and eye strain: Excessive use of computers can lead to eye strain and other health issues, such as sleep disturbances and mental health problems.
